The feedback page shows a 'satisfaction rating' with the percentage of people
who 'found what they were looking for' in its related article. The current
version of this rating is only based on the last 30 feedback posts, including
posts that were resolved or hidden. This doesn't seem right.
We propose to change the formula for that 'satisfaction rating', to base it on
all posts that have NOT been marked as 'resolved', 'inappropriate', 'hidden' or
'oversighted'. So this count would include unreviewed posts, as well as posts
that were marked as 'useful' or 'no action needed'. We also propose to remove
the current 30-post limit, because it is confusing, arbitrary and inconsistent
with the posts that are being shown to users.
